Output e6bac888859f4df7f13b5942860fb89fbea1c895be2c359ba06a1464bf168e1e:1

value
144800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a247f6c5f551160a17c781a6680c6410b7f565bc OP_EQUALVERIFY OP_CHECKSIG
address
1Fo4gDm4kDBy7XJJCteMDAv33cS4Uxti5U
transaction
e6bac888859f4df7f13b5942860fb89fbea1c895be2c359ba06a1464bf168e1e
confirmations
557880
spent
true